ROBREDO – Philippine Vice President Leni Robredo believes that the healthcare system must be prioritized by the new administration.

The Philippines is drawing near to a new administration as the current terms of the incumbent leaders are about to end. A national election is set to be held in 2022 and the voter registration for the next poll is ongoing.

The voter registration deadline is set on September 30, 2021 but there might be changes considering the calls for extension. Both the bills of the Senate and the House of Representatives seeking the extension of the voter registration period were passed on final reading.

If there are no significant differences between the Senate Bill and the House of Representatives Bill, the bills may be passed to the Office of the President for approval. The filing of the candidacies is set to start until October 8.

Vice President Leni Robredo

Several politicians have already announced their political plans for the next election. One of those whose announcement is still awaited is Vice Pres. Leni Robredo. She is vocal that she is not giving up in the pursuit to unite the opposition and will make a due announcement.

Based on a report on ABS-CBN News, Vice Pres. Robredo believes that the healthcare system must be prioritized by the new administration. She stressed that there is really a need to stop the spread of the virus.

“Ang tanong lagi eh, ‘what are we doing wrong?’ Kasi one and a half years na tayo dito, parang rollercoaster ‘yung ating (COVID-19) numbers. Bubuti, sasama, bubuti, sasama,” she said.

According to the Vice President, the country cannot move on from the impacts of the COVID-19 pandemic as long as the nation continues to record new cases of the disease. She stressed that the Filipinos must learn to “live with the virus” – not taking it for granted and with the willingness to shift to a new normal with recognition of the situation experienced amid the pandemic.

As for her possible presidential bid, Vice Pres. Robredo stressed that what is meant to happen will happen. She has always been vocal of her belief that the presidency is not something planned well but it is by fate. For now, she is using the last remaining days before the filing of candidacy begins to unite the opposition.
